Overview
In the Modern Campus Network Design course participants learn about industry trends and challenges driving a cloud-based approach to network design. This is a great course for IT professionals and network architects who want to embrace the latest industry trends and best practices.
A successful modern network architect requires a keen understanding of business requirements, network components, and the challenges of architecting good solutions. In the 1-hour Modern Campus Network Design course you’ll get a high level overview of key network design topics trending in the Edge era. Typical candidates for this course are individuals who are IT Professionals and/or Network Engineers/ architects who want to learn about Aruba’s modern approach to network design. Participants should have a basic understanding of wired/wireless computer networking and be familiar with network design.
